This episode of the podcast explores the meaning, usage, and connotation of "fuss over", a phrasal verb that means to give someone or something a lot of attention and care. "Fuss over" can have both positive and negative connotations. It can be used to express affection or care, or to express annoyance or frustration. The hosts provide several examples and anecdotes to illustrate its usage and offer alternative phrases like "make a fuss" and "commotion." They stress the importance of using it in context to convey its intended meaning.
